be performed in accordance with standards of professional school nurse practice, state board of education policies and procedures and the State of Illinois Nurse Practice Act. Principal Accountabilities The CSN provides and/or delegates to licensed personnel direct professional nursing services, first aid, illness, and emergency care to students.
The CSN identifies health problems, makes referrals for diagnosis and treatment, develops educational modifications, provides follow-up and evaluation, and maintains appropriate documentation. The CSN provides counseling and follow-up services to students with disabilities as delineated in the IEP/504. The CSN follows up on homebound students
needing related health care services. The CSN provides intervention in times of school crisis, i. e. death, suicide, traumatic events. The CSN initiates, encourages, and participates in health education programs for children.
The CSN assists special education children to accept or adjust to physical, emotional or health limitations. The CSN provides health counseling to parents of special education students, and provides individual and group health counseling to special education students. The CSN develops the medication protocol to safely store, administer, document, and monitor the effectiveness of the medication given at school. The CSN coordinates activities of local schools concerned
with communicable disease regulations. The CSN assists with the State and Federal mandated screenings and provides follow-up for deficits in vision, hearing, growth and development, and other physical impairments.
The CSN collaborates with the multidisciplinary team to determine if health adversely affects the student's educational process and is also responsible for the development of the all IEP goals, benchmarks, and accommodations for students requiring health related services.
